Job Summary We are seeking a Finance Director to join our team in a hybrid position, based in MO. As a key member of the US leadership team and reporting into the VP of Finance for Introba, the successful candidate will play a crucial role in shaping the financial direction of the US Region. Responsibilities & Qualifications

Duties and Responsibilities:

Financial Planning and Analysis:

  • Develop and implement comprehensive financial plans and budgets aligned with the region's strategic goals.

  • Conduct regular financial analysis and forecasting to provide insights into business performance and support decision-making processes.

Risk Management:

  • Assess and manage financial risks, implementing strategies to mitigate potential issues.

  • Stay abreast of industry trends and economic indicators to anticipate potential challenges and opportunities.

Financial Reporting:

  • Oversee the preparation of accurate and timely financial statements, ensuring compliance with relevant accounting standards and regulations.

  • Present financial reports to the US leadership team, providing clear insights and recommendations.

Cash Flow Management:

  • Manage cash flow to optimize working capital and support operational needs.

  • Implement effective cash management strategies to ensure liquidity and financial stability.

Financial Leadership:

  • Collaborate with executive leadership to develop and execute financial strategies that support the region's growth and expansion plans.

Compliance and Governance:

  • Ensure compliance with relevant financial regulations, laws, and industry standards.

  • Implement and maintain robust internal controls and governance processes.

Team Leadership:

  • Lead and mentor the US finance team, fostering a culture of accountability, professional development, and collaboration.

  • Build cross-functional relationships with other departments to facilitate effective communication and collaboration.

Qualifications:

  • Bachelor's degree in finance, Accounting, or a related field; MBA or CPA preferred.

  • Proven experience as a financial leader in a similar capacity within the engineering services or related industry.

  • Strong understanding of financial management, accounting principles, and regulatory compliance.

  • Excellent analytical, strategic thinking, and problem-solving skills.

  • Effective communication and presentation skills with the ability to convey complex financial information to non-financial stakeholders.

  • Demonstrated leadership experience with the ability to inspire and motivate a high-performing finance team.

  • Proven track record of driving financial success and contributing to organizational growth.
